Till date, the Faculty of Management and Commerce has completed three sponsored projects: 

  • Technology Gap Analysis for Mysore Painting Cluster with TIFAC
  • Market Research Analysis for SKF Ltd. 
  • DST — Green innovation

At present, the Faculty is working on the project Technology Gap Analysis of Channapatna Toys Cluster’.
